General Information about #05581E

The hexadecimal color code #05581E, commonly referred to as Camarone, represents a dark shade of green. It's composed of 2.0% red, 34.5% green, and 12.2% blue. In the RGB color model, it is defined as (5, 88, 30). This color is often associated with nature, growth, and tranquility. The low red and blue values contribute to its deep green appearance. In the HSV (hue, saturation, value) color space, Camarone has a hue of 137 degrees, a saturation of 94.3%, and a value of 34.5%. This means it's a highly saturated, relatively dark green. The color #05581E, also known as Camarone, presents accessibility challenges due to its low luminance. Its dark nature results in a low contrast ratio against standard white backgrounds, potentially making text and other visual elements difficult to perceive for users with visual impairments. It is crucial to ensure that sufficient contrast is provided when using this color for text or interactive elements. A cont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al-sized text and 3:1 for large text (14pt bold or 18pt regular) to comply with WCAG guidelines. Utilizing lighter colors for text or interface elements on a Camarone background is advisable to enhance readability and ensure inclusivity.
